Output d24f665eea14d64ee1f3f2b04df3922e824c9e6c1fb5eb94c3b190a24c712343:0

value
8793287
script pubkey
OP_HASH160 OP_PUSHBYTES_20 95b1ae1e067cc1a36f9a28a169496ae8027625f5 OP_EQUAL
address
MMYfmSpAJbG5EaYj7BETxR11DFXUkhRtju
transaction
d24f665eea14d64ee1f3f2b04df3922e824c9e6c1fb5eb94c3b190a24c712343
spent
true